コガネブログ

平日更新を目標に Unity や C#、Visual Studio、ReSharper などのゲーム開発アレコレを書いていきます

【Unity】メッシュを変形できる「ShaderGum」紹介

はじめに

「ShaderGum」を Unity プロジェクトに導入することで
メッシュを変形できるようになります

使用例

f:id:baba_s:20180429144647g:plain

クイックスタート

f:id:baba_s:20180429144739p:plain

Shader に「VertexTexture/Mesh」を設定したマテリアルを用意します

f:id:baba_s:20180429144842p:plain

メッシュを変形されたいオブジェクトにコライダと「Vertex To Texture」をアタッチします
「Material」には用意したマテリアルを設定します

f:id:baba_s:20180429144909p:plain

カメラに「Paint」をアタッチします
「Cursor」にはマウスカーソルの位置を表示するオブジェクトを設定します

関連記事